## Break-Glass Access: Eventline Schema Registry

If the Eventline schema registry at Corvax becomes unreachable and normal admin login fails, contractors may invoke the break-glass flow. First confirm with the on-call lead that both primary and replica nodes are down. Then open the sealed recovery console from the ops bastion and select "registry-restore." The console will prompt for the recovery passphrase before unlocking write access, so have it ready.

vault phrase of fahog-yajog = frawyn-jordor-casael-gormir-olieth-julmir

**Facilities Ticket — Contractor First Week Setup**

Requesting night-shift support for a contractor from Vintermark Fitters starting Monday at the Copperleigh Annex. Please ensure the tool store is unlocked by 21:30 each evening and that the freight lift is left in service mode. Until a permanent badge is issued, the contractor will use the temporary door code below.

door code, yagap-bahof: bdg-O-05

Handover — Kiosk watchdog (Plinthview app)

Watchdog restarts the kiosk shell if heartbeat misses 3 ticks. Currently flapping on units at the Marrow Street depot; suspect clock drift, not the app. I bumped the tolerance to 5 ticks on staging — don't ship to prod until Dagny signs off. Logs land in the usual bucket. If the watchdog config service locks you out, use account recovery on the Plinthview console. The passphrase you'll need is below:

strongbox words: gilok-druion-briath-wendor-briion-prawyn-fenion-oliir-casdor-holius-briius-gilath-gilael-pelys

Hi team,

Quick handover on the ShelfStream catalogue import before I'm off. The big Wrenmoor Library batch lands Monday; the importer handles duplicate ISBN-style records fine now, so expect fewer tickets about doubled entries. If customers report stalled imports, check the staging queue first — it backs up after large batches. Support can retrigger imports themselves, but the signed job manifest needs re-verification each time. Verify against the deploy key below.

release key, yahop-taweg: bky13_SAixXgwoYUmAf